| 22:02:43 | flwang | mriedem: jaypipes: is there a config option in nova.conf to set the default volume type? | |
| 22:04:12 | jaypipes | flwang: sorry, I have node idea :( mriedem probably is your best bet. (I didn't even think we *supported* volume types actually..) | |
| 22:04:32 | openstackgerrit | Eric Fried proposed openstack/nova master: WIP: Use a static resource tracker in the compute manager https://review.openstack.org/620711 | |
| 22:04:42 | efried | jaypipes: Let's see how the gate feels about that ^ | |
| 22:04:59 | flwang | jaypipes: nova supports it in master(stein) | |
| 22:05:51 | mriedem | flwang: no, cinder has a config for the default volume type | |
| 22:06:12 | mriedem | nova only passes the volume type through, otherwise nova creates volumes w/o any volume type and you get the default from cinder | |

| 22:59:23 | mriedem | mordred: we should only need the endpoint type (volumev3) and interface (public) to look up a service catalog entry right? we don't need the service name for that, | |
| 22:59:35 | mordred | that is correct | |
| 22:59:38 | mriedem | unless you have multiple endpoints pointed at the same type and interface but with different names or something? | |
| 22:59:47 | mriedem | trying to sort out what i can do for https://bugs.launchpad.net/nova/+bug/1803627 | |
| 22:59:47 | openstack | Launchpad bug 1803627 in OpenStack Compute (nova) "Nova requires you to name your volumev3 service cinderv3" [Undecided,New] | |
| 23:00:15 | jaypipes | efried: I'm quite concerned about https://review.openstack.org/#/c/615677/ | |
| 23:00:17 | mordred | the only time service name is ever useful for anything is if a cloud has gotten itself into a bad place and has more than one endpoint with the same service type like rackspace public cloud did during their transition from legacy to openstack | |
